      Just recently we had a rain storm that dumped probably 2 inches in an hour or so. I noticed later on that night that the wall facing a gutter that was overflowing is now wet in a few spots. I’ve never had this before. The wall is brick and my question is this: Should I do anything about this since it is just a little moisture or could it lead to bigger concerns?

      You got the water because the gutter was overflowing during an exceptional downpoor. It was like pouring hundreds of gallons of water next to your foundation and hoping for it to not leak. You may want to make sure your dirt is graded to slope away from your house and be sure your downspouts are OPEN along with eves.
